The Shipper-Receiver is tasked with keeping workstations clean manually receiving products, inputting receipts into the receiving program, and ensuring proper labelling for inventory control.

The role also involves performing daily equipment inspections, being open to assignments in other areas, and prioritizing safety and cleanliness in the workplace You may be assigned work in other areas to accommodate production requirements.


Essential Job functions:


  • The Shipper/Receiver is responsible for keeping the workstation clean at all times.
  • Required to pick, label, stage and ship customer and warehouse orders according to established methods.
  • Will be required to perform various warehousing duties including stock rotation, storage of products by location, physical inventory.
  • Required manually receiving products into the operations and posting.
  • The receipts into the receiving program, as well as attaching all identification labels on the product for inventory and picking control.
  • Perform daily preshift inspection of material handling equipment and fill in the inspection documentation.
  • Prerequisites include the possibilities of work assigned in other areas on a needed basis, the willingness to teach/learn shipping/receiving techniques to/from others, the proven efforts to maintain work areas' cleanliness, and the ensured safety awareness/practices for self and others in the workplace.
  • Responsible and reliable
  • Ability to work the day shift from 7:00am to 3:30pm.

Garland Commercial Ranges has been a leading manufacturer for over 60 years which designs and produces a full line of commercial ovens, ranges, griddles, grills, conveyor ovens & countertop cooking equipment.

The products are sold to leading fast food chains as well as independent restaurants in +100 countries. The facility in Mississauga is a division of Welbilt, Inc.
